#Computers #Computer peripherals #Computer repair & maintenance #Saskatoon #SK #saskatchewan #Computers #Computer peripherals #Computer repair & maintenance #417310-Computer # Computer Peripheral and Pre-Packaged Software Merchant Wholesalers